Duke Homecare & Hospice Duke Homecare & Hospice offers hospice, home health and infusion services as well as serves as the home for the Duke Caregiver Support Program. Our Hospice team works closely with a patient's physician to provide comprehensive, individualized care in the comfort their home or at our inpatient hospice facility located in Durham. Our team of nurses, therapists, social workers, counselors, and chaplains help patients and their families manage advanced medical conditions. Duke Home Health provides services in a patient's home that include skilled nursing, physical therapy, occupational therapy, speech therapy, social service, home health aides, and pain and wound management. Our infusion team comes to a patient's home to administer intravenous medications, including antibiotics and chemotherapy, to children and adults. Our nurses, pharmacists, dietitians, and patient services coordinators work under the direction of a patient's doctor to monitor needs and treatment.

Duke HomeCare & Hospice Position Description

 


In addition to the responsibilities and requirements described in the Duke job description, the Duke HomeCare & Hospice Social Worker will be responsible for:

 

JOB SUMMARY

Provides psychosocial assessments, intervention, and /or treatment related to the patient’s illness, and/or life situation. Identifies community resources to assist and meet the continuing needs of the patient and family in the home environment. May evaluate patients referred to the hospice program for admission

MAJOR JOB RESPONSIBILITIES

 

  • Maintains up to date knowledge of Medicare/Medicaid/JCAHO regulations.
  • Provide psychosocial assessments of patients and family to identify emotional, social, and environmental strengths and problems related to their diagnosis, illness, treatment, and/or life situation.
  • Formulate, develop, and implement a comprehensive psychosocial treatment plan utilizing appropriate social work treatment and interventions.  Interventions may include crisis intervention brief and long-term individual, family therapy as well as grief and bereavement work. 
  • Collaborate with the health care team and involve the patient/family in the development and implementation of plans.
  • Provide education and counseling to patients and families around issues related to adaptation to the patient’s diagnosis, illness, treatment and adaptation to end of life issues.
  • Maintain working knowledge of and liaison with community agencies; participate in area activities.
  • Assist with screening, identification and management of victims of abuse, neglect, domestic violence, rape, etc.  Make referrals as appropriate and serves as resource for the health care team
  • Will participate in on-call or after hour’s coverage.
  • Document assessment, plan, interactions and interventions according to departmental guidelines and standards.
  • Participate and represent social work perspective in multidisciplinary teams, rounds, etc.
  • Maintain a working knowledge of relevant medical/legal issues that impact on patient care, e.g., advance directives, child and elder abuse, etc.
  • Serve as patient advocate.
  • Maintain records and statistics in accordance with department policies.
  • Attend and participate in staff, committee, department, and other administrative meetings.
  • Keep current with social work and health care developments and seek to increase further enhancement of job related knowledge.
  • Provide education to other health care professionals.
  • Maintains confidentiality of employee and patient information.
